Carlos Alberto Sánchez Moreno (born February 6, 1986 in Quibdó ) is a Colombian football player .
Career
society
Sánchez started his career with Danubio FC from Montevideo . From Clausura 2006 to Clausura 2007 he was in the squad in the Uruguayan capital at River Plate Montevideo .
In mid-2007 he moved to Europe for Valenciennes FC . He made his debut in Ligue 1 , the highest league in France , on August 4, 2007, the first match day. In the 3-1 win over FC Toulouse , he was in the starting line-up and prepared Johan Audel's 1-0 opening goal in the 5th minute . After five years he left France for South America. He signed a contract with Rangers de Talca in Chile . But it was loaned straight back to its old club. After the loan expired, he moved to the Spanish Primera División for FC Elche in 2013 .
After two years with the English club Aston Villa , Sánchez switched to AC Florence on loan . After 31 games in the 2016/17 season , he was signed before the loan expired.
On January 31, 2018, Espanyol Barcelona announced their signing.
After his return to Fiorentina , the English first division side West Ham United signed him on a free transfer.
National team
He made his debut for Colombia on May 9, 2007 in a friendly against Panama . He was a member of the 2007 and 2011 Copa America squad. Sánchez was on the squad for the 2014 World Cup in Brazil .
He was part of the Colombian squad at the 2018 World Cup in Brazil . He came to three missions and was eliminated with the team in the round of 16 against England on penalties.
